Structured evidence summary
Research question
The article discusses whether tuberculosis eradication targets are achievable and identifies challenges that must be addressed under the WHO End TB Strategy.
Study design
This is a peer-reviewed journal article presenting a discussion of tuberculosis eradication and control priorities. The supplied abstract does not describe a primary study population, data collection method, or statistical analysis.
Population and setting
The discussion concerns tuberculosis globally, including settings where treatment delays and medicine stock-outs are described. No defined participant sample or specific study site is provided.
Main findings
The article identifies improved detection and treatment of drug-susceptible and drug-resistant tuberculosis, infection control, patient-cost reduction, and stronger funding as priorities. It also reports that the multidrug-resistant tuberculosis cure rate was 50% and characterizes a vaccine becoming available by 2025 as highly improbable.
